Hi @karttikeya

I understand the notion of shifting the dataset to have the same origin. You also multiply the trajectories by 1.86.

  • Is this number has any significance?
  • Is it the same hyper-parameter used for ETH as well?

Regards
Kapil

We noticed scaling the data helped slightly with better optimization (note, same effect might be possible by tuning lambda1 & lambda2 instead). To keep other hyperparameters the same, we scaled the ETH trajectories to be on the order of magnitude of SDD trajectories ( about 170 I believe).
